Description
本創作係有關於一種治具結構,尤其是指一種能供直接架設於待加工件上,同時對待加工件兩側相對應位置進行定位,以利於榫槽之加工切削作業,不僅在操作使用上更具簡易便利性,且更能達到準確定位功效,而在其整體施行使用上更增實用功效特性的治具結構創新設計者。This creation is about a jig structure, especially a kind that can be directly erected on the workpiece to be processed, and at the same time, the corresponding positions of the two sides of the workpiece to be processed are positioned to facilitate the machining and cutting operation of the tongue and groove, not only in operation and use It is more simple and convenient, and can achieve accurate positioning effect, and it is an innovative designer of fixture structure that has more practical functional characteristics in its overall implementation.
按,人們於日常生活周遭充斥著各種的木製傢俱、木製用品等由木材所製作的產品,由於該類木材製作的產品具有極佳的質感,使得其深受人們的喜愛。According to the press, people's daily life is full of various wooden furniture, wooden products and other products made of wood. Because the products made of such wood have an excellent texture, they are deeply loved by people.
其中,一般該類木製產品於進行各類榫槽開設時,其皆係以一定位件設置於木材之一側,於對應該定位件將該木材一側進行切削後,再將該定位件移至該木材相對之另一側,同樣利用刀具對應該定位件將該木材另一側進行相對切削,以能於該木材上開設有連通之榫槽。Among them, when these types of wooden products are used to open various types of tongues and grooves, they are all provided with a positioning member on one side of the wood. After cutting the side of the wood corresponding to the positioning member, the positioning member is moved. Up to the opposite side of the wood, the opposite side of the wood is also cut by the cutter corresponding to the positioning member, so that the wood can be provided with a connecting tongue and groove.
然而,上述定位件雖可達到用來對木材進行定位開設榫槽之預期功效,但也在其實際操作施行使用上發現,該結構僅能對木材單一側先進行定位予以切削,再移至另一側進行定位切削,造成其使用上之極大不便,且更容易有定位不準確的情況發生,致令其在整體結構設計上仍存在有改進的空間。However, although the above positioning member can achieve the expected effect of positioning and opening the tongue and groove on the wood, it is also found in its actual operation and use that the structure can only be positioned and cut on a single side of the wood, and then moved to another Positioning and cutting on one side causes great inconvenience in its use and is more likely to cause inaccurate positioning, resulting in room for improvement in the overall structural design.

其主要係包括有支撐板及夾掣塊;其中:Its main parts include supporting plates and clamping blocks; among them:
該支撐板,其分別形成有相對應之第一側與第二側,於該第一側凹設有兩相對之第一導槽,而於該第二側則凹設有兩相對之第二導槽;The supporting plate is respectively formed with a corresponding first side and a second side, two opposite first guide grooves are recessed on the first side, and two opposite second recesses are recessed on the second side Guide slot
該夾掣塊,其頂端對應該支撐板之該第一導槽與該第二導槽凸設有相配合套設結合之結合部。At the top of the clamping block, the first guide groove and the second guide groove of the supporting plate are protrudingly provided with a coupling portion which is matched and sleeved together.
本創作治具結構的較佳實施例,其中,該支撐板於該第一側之該第一導槽上端面貫穿開設有第一長槽孔,且於該第二側之該第二導槽上端面貫穿開設有第二長槽孔,並於該夾掣塊之該結合部上端面開設有定位孔,令定位件經由該第一導槽之該第一長槽孔、該第二導槽之該第二長槽孔與該定位孔結合固定。A preferred embodiment of the authoring jig structure, wherein the supporting plate is provided with a first long slot hole through the upper end surface of the first guide groove on the first side, and the second guide groove on the second side A second long slot hole is formed through the upper end surface, and a positioning hole is formed on the upper end surface of the joint portion of the clamping block, so that the positioning member passes through the first long slot hole and the second guide slot of the first guide slot The second long slot hole is fixed in combination with the positioning hole.
本創作治具結構的較佳實施例,其中,該支撐板為六邊形。In a preferred embodiment of the authoring jig structure, the support plate is hexagonal.
本創作治具結構的較佳實施例,其中,該夾掣塊為鳩尾狀、矩形狀任一種。In a preferred embodiment of the jig structure of the present invention, the clamping block is in a dovetail shape or a rectangular shape.
本創作治具結構的較佳實施例,其中,該支撐板之該第一、二導槽為上寬下窄之鳩尾槽狀,該夾掣塊之該結合部對應該第一、二導槽亦呈上寬下窄之鳩尾槽狀。A preferred embodiment of the present fixture structure, wherein the first and second guide grooves of the support plate are dovetail grooves with an upper width and a lower width, and the joint portion of the clamping block corresponds to the first and second guide grooves It also has a dovetail groove that is wide at the top and narrow at the bottom.

首先,請參閱第一圖本創作之立體組合結構示意圖及第二圖本創作之第一實施例立體組合結構示意圖所示,本創作主要係包括有支撐板(1)及夾掣塊(2);其中:First of all, please refer to the schematic diagram of the three-dimensional assembly structure of the first picture creation and the schematic diagram of the three-dimensional assembly structure of the first embodiment of the second picture creation. This creation mainly includes a supporting plate (1) and a clamping block (2) ;among them:
該支撐板(1),其可為六邊形,於該支撐板(1)分別形成有相對應之第一側(11)與第二側(12),於該第一側(11)凹設有兩相對之第一導槽(111),而於該第二側則凹設有兩相對之第二導槽(121),該第一導槽(111)與該第二導槽(121)為上寬下窄之鳩尾槽狀。The supporting plate (1) may be hexagonal, and a corresponding first side (11) and a second side (12) are formed on the supporting plate (1) respectively, and concave on the first side (11) Two opposite first guide grooves (111) are provided, and two opposite second guide grooves (121) are recessed on the second side, the first guide groove (111) and the second guide groove (121) ) Is a dovetail groove with a wide width and a narrow width.
該夾掣塊(2),其可為鳩尾狀或矩形狀,於該夾掣塊(2)頂端對應該支撐板(1)之該第一導槽(111)與該第二導槽(121)凸設有相配合套設結合之結合部(21),該結合部(21)可對應該第一導槽(111)與該第二導槽(121)亦呈上寬下窄之鳩尾槽狀。The clamping block (2) can be dovetail-shaped or rectangular. The top of the clamping block (2) corresponds to the first guide groove (111) and the second guide groove (121) of the support plate (1) ) There is a coupling part (21) which is matched with the sleeve, and the coupling part (21) can correspond to the first guide groove (111) and the second guide groove (121), which also has a dovetail groove with an upper width and a lower width shape.
如此一來,使得本創作於操作使用上,即能將該支撐板(1)抵靠於欲進行切割之待加工件上端,且將數該夾掣塊(2)以該結合部(21)分別與該支撐板(1)之該第一導槽(111)與該第二導槽(121)相套設結合,並可依該待加工件之厚度分別於該第一導槽(111)與該第二導槽(121)移動調整該夾掣塊(2)之位置[請再一併參閱第三圖本創作之夾掣塊移動調整狀態結構示意圖及第四圖本創作之夾掣塊移動調整狀態剖視結構示意圖所示],即可令該待加工件夾掣在套設結合於該第一導槽(111)與該第二導槽(121)之該夾掣塊(2)之間,讓該夾掣塊(2)貼靠在該待加工件兩側端面,而即能對該待加工件兩側端面之該夾掣塊(2)所標示出的部位進行各項相關作業。In this way, the author can use the support plate (1) against the upper end of the to-be-processed part to be cut, and count the clamping block (2) with the joint part (21) The first guide groove (111) and the second guide groove (121) of the support plate (1) are respectively sleeved and combined, and can be respectively in the first guide groove (111) according to the thickness of the workpiece to be processed Move the second guide slot (121) to adjust the position of the clamping block (2) [Please refer to the schematic diagram of the movement adjustment state of the clamping block created in the third picture and the clamping block created in the fourth picture The schematic diagram of the cross-sectional structure of the movement adjustment state] can be used to clamp the to-be-processed part in the clamping block (2) which is combined with the first guide groove (111) and the second guide groove (121) Between, let the clamping block (2) abut on the two end surfaces of the to-be-processed part, that is, the parts marked by the clamping block (2) on the two end surfaces of the to-be-processed part can be related operation.
另,請再一併參閱第五圖本創作之第二實施例立體分解結構示意圖及第六圖本創作之第三實施例立體分解結構示意圖所示,該支撐板(1)於該第一側(11)之該第一導槽(111)上端面貫穿開設有第一長槽孔(112),且於該第二側(12)之該第二導槽(121)上端面貫穿開設有第二長槽孔(122),並於該夾掣塊(2)之該結合部(21)上端面開設有定位孔(211),令定位件(22)經由該第一導槽(111)之該第一長槽孔(112)或該第二導槽(121)之該第二長槽孔(122)與該定位孔(211)結合固定[請再一併參閱第七圖本創作之第二實施例組合剖視結構示意圖及第八圖本創作之第三實施例組合剖視結構示意圖所示],該定位件(22)可為螺固件;使得於令該待加工件夾掣在套設結合於該第一導槽(111)與該第二導槽(121)之該夾掣塊(2)之間時,能同時利用定位件(22)經由該第一導槽(111)之該第一長槽孔(112)或該第二導槽(121)之該第二長槽孔(122)與該定位孔(211)結合固定,讓該夾掣塊(2)更為確實穩固將該待加工件夾掣方便,以更能便於對該待加工件兩側端面之該夾掣塊(2)所標示出的部位進行各項相關作業。In addition, please also refer to the schematic diagram of the three-dimensional exploded structure of the second embodiment of the fifth picture creation and the schematic diagram of the three-dimensional exploded structure of the third embodiment of the sixth picture creation, the supporting plate (1) is on the first side (11) The first guide slot (111) has a first long slot hole (112) penetrating through the upper end surface, and the second guide slot (121) has a first slot penetrating through the upper end surface on the second side (12) Two long slot holes (122), and a positioning hole (211) is opened on the upper end surface of the joint portion (21) of the clamping block (2), so that the positioning member (22) passes through the first guide slot (111) The first long slot (112) or the second long slot (122) of the second guide slot (121) and the positioning hole (211) are combined and fixed [Please refer to the seventh drawing The schematic view of the combined sectional structure of the second embodiment and the eighth figure are shown in the schematic view of the combined sectional structure of the third embodiment of this creation], the positioning member (22) may be a screw fastener; so that the workpiece to be processed is clamped in the sleeve When it is combined between the clamping block (2) of the first guide groove (111) and the second guide groove (121), the positioning member (22) can be used to pass through the first guide groove (111) at the same time The first long slot hole (112) or the second long slot hole (122) of the second guide slot (121) is combined with the positioning hole (211) to fix the clamping block (2) more surely It is convenient to clamp the workpiece to be processed, so as to be more convenient for performing various related operations on the portion marked by the clamping block (2) on the two end surfaces of the workpiece to be processed.
